Transaction 03830451764d0db05ef90f6b2399d04f7b38905efa02041c20a59cc3233b719f

2 Input
2 Outputs
  • 03830451764d0db05ef90f6b2399d04f7b38905efa02041c20a59cc3233b719f:0
  • value  12804898
    address  1HnXYERWQgszFhcFEycDRmpE4GFHhonDWM
  • 03830451764d0db05ef90f6b2399d04f7b38905efa02041c20a59cc3233b719f:1
  • value  20000000
    address  1FzuVAnLatnLTVWKwST56EH9MUBp83Ceqh